Join us for Scenic Visions: The Future of Arlington on May 29th, where Arlington’s civic leaders, business leaders, and visionaries will discuss challenges, opportunities, and the potential of Jacksonville's Arlington community.
Moderator Joyce Morgan will be joined by panelists Tim Cost, president of Jacksonville University; Steve Matchett, executive director of Old Arlington Inc., Trish Kapustka, president of JAX Chamber Arlington Council, Rory Dubin, president of the NE Florida Association of Realtors, and Karen Nasrallah, redevelopment manager - City of Jacksonville.
The event is free, but seating is limited to 100 and **registration is required** for each individual. Please visit www.scenicjax.org for registration and more information.

Light refreshments provided courtesy of Jacksonville University.
The Frisch Welcome Center is the Office of Admissions on University Oaks Drive just inside the gates from University Boulevard. Free parking is available in the surface lots in front of the Frisch Center.
This event is the finale of a three part series spotlighting the Arlington community of Jacksonville, Florida, brought to you by Scenic Jacksonville, Old Arlington Inc, JAX Chamber Arlington Council, Greater Arlington Civic Council, and Jacksonville University.
